Best Books from 2010
I’m not very apt at making best of lists. I’m especially crap at trying to keep it as a top 10, or anything neat and orderly. So I decided to split it into sub-sections, and even then I found it difficult. I realised, though, that this is a great thing. It means I read lots of wonderful things, which I did. It’s been a great reading year, and I want to thank you all for keeping me company. Out of the 118 books I read, these are my favourites, in no order:
[Oh! Important note: I didn’t include more than one book per author, even when I’d read several that deserved to be on here.]
Essays
- On Solitude (And Other Essays) by Michel de Montaigne
- The Art of War by Sun-Tzu
- A Room of One’s Own by Virginia Woolf
- Books v. Cigarettes by George Orwell
- Days of Reading by Marcel Proust
Non-fiction
- Half a Life by Darin Strauss
- A Heartbreaking Work of Staggering Genius by Dave Eggers
- The Eden Express by Mark Vonnegut
- The Year of Magical Thinking by Joan Didion
- The Diving Bell and the Butterfly by Jean-Dominique Bauby
- The Man Who Mistook His Wife for a Hat by Oliver Sacks
- The Polysyllabic Spree by Nick Hornby
Classics
- Paradise Lost by John Milton
- To The Lighthouse by Virginia Woolf
- Siddhartha by Hermann Hesse
- Down and Out in Paris and London by George Orwell
- Lolita by Vladimir Nabokov
- The Sonnets and A Lover’s Complaint by Shakespeare
Contemporary
- The Easter Parade by Richard Yates
- Franny and Zooey by J. D. Salinger
- Cathedral by Raymond Carver
- Music for Chameleons by Truman Capote
- South of the Border, West of the Sun by Haruki Murakami
- Written on the Body by Jeanette Winterson
- Never Let Me Go by Kazuo Ishiguro
- The Brief Wondrous Life of Oscar Wao by Junot Díaz
- So Many Ways to Begin by Jon McGregor
- The Road by Cormac McCarthy
- One Day by David Nicholls
- Half Broke Horses by Jeannette Walls
- Freedom by Jonathan Franzen
- Room by Emma Donoghue
- By Nightfall by Michael Cunningham
